Combining exceptional expertise in sugar beet breeding with state-of-the-art technology and strict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) to produce premium white sugar — serving Egypt, the Middle East, and North Africa since 2014.
Agricultural innovation at the source — harvesting premium beets across Al Sharkeya Governorate.
State-of-the-art receiving facilities built on 420 feddans in New Sakhya City.
Advanced processing units delivering premium white sugar at industrial scale.
Rigorous quality control ensuring every batch meets the highest GMP standards.

Performance is evaluated by contribution, conduct, and delivery. Successful completion requires ≥90% attendance, all tasks completed, final project submitted, and professional conduct throughout.
We understand you might have a few questions as you embark on this exciting journey. Here are some of the most common inquiries from our interns, designed to help you settle in with ease and confidence.
Smart casual attire is appropriate for the office. For your safety on the plant floor, please ensure you wear closed-toe shoes.
Standard working hours are 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M, Sunday through Thursday, aligning with our company's operational schedule.
Yes, a certificate of successful completion will be awarded to all interns who maintain at least 90% attendance and fulfill all program requirements.
Department placement is carefully determined based on your academic background, skills, and the most relevant available projects within our company.
Your department supervisor is your primary point of contact. For any further concerns, you can reach out to our Human Resources or OD team.
Yes! You will complete a case study and deliver a final presentation to your department. Your overall assessment is based on task completion, professional conduct, attendance, and the quality of your project and presentation.
